Paul Kent Memorial 2007
Kiwi have been fairly busy over the past month with many swimmers busily attending meets all over the north island.
We had a team of 27 swimmers head down to Levin to compete at the Paul Kent Memorial, The Kiwi swimmers had a great time with many of our new swimmers stepping up a notch.
Meet highlights
- Just over 70% of Kiwi swimmers gained a personal best time (Pb)
- Cameron Blair took off 12.84 secs off his 200 Back
- Jessica Love took off 21.48 sec off her 200 IM
- Eve Athersuch and Cameron Gibbons both Pb all of their events
- Kiwi swimmers were among the top 5 places 85 times
- The highlight of the meet would have to be winning the Paul Kent Memorial Trophy, A fantastic trophy that we are more than happy to accept.
Pb times are compared with times from the last time swimmers swum that course (SC - SC)
